This charming mid-terrace house with historic origins (built around 1750) is located in an absolutely central downtown location in Homburg and combines the character of a mature old building with generous room dimensions.
The property has approx. 138 m² of living space, complemented by an additionally converted usable area of approx. 68 m², which can be used in a variety of ways – for example as a work area, hobby rooms, guest rooms or additional storage space. A total of 6 rooms and 3 bathrooms are available, making the house ideal for families or multi-generational households.
The building was constructed using solid construction methods and has been maintained over the years. Heating is provided by a gas heating system dating from around 1980. The windows were replaced in 1994 and are double-glazed. The roof dates from 1975. Tiled and laminate flooring provides functional living comfort.
A particular highlight is the central location in Homburg city centre: shops, schools, doctors, restaurants and public transport are all within walking distance.
